INTRODUCTION

  • Read through all of the instructions before starting installation.

  • Notifications and warning texts are for your safety and to minimise the risk of something breaking during installation.

  • Ensure that all tools stated in the instructions are available before starting installation.

  • Certain steps in the instructions are only presented in the form of images. Explanatory text is also given for more complicated steps.

  • In the event of any problems with the instructions or the accessory, contact your local Volvo dealer.

  

Note!

This accessory requires software unique to the car.


 

Preparations

1
A8800136
 

Preparations

  • Turn the ignition key to position 0

  • Remove the key from the ignition switch (does not apply to cars with automatic gearboxes)

  • Disconnect the battery negative lead.


    Note!

    Wait at least five minutes before disassembling the connectors or removing other electrical equipment.


 

Removing the door mirror

2
D8401034
 

Removing the door mirror

Carry out steps - on both the left and right-hand sides.

    Removing the painted cover

  • Remove the painted cover (1). Carefully pull the top edge of the cover backwards and upwards by hand

  • If the cover is secured too tightly to remove by hand, use a weatherstrip tool. Insert the weatherstrip tool between the cover and the surround for the mirror. Pry the cover backwards and upwards.

Illustration A applies to the S60 and the V70 (00-)

    Remove:

  • the cover (1) for the door mirror. Pull the cover straight out

  • the clips (2). First press in the centre of the clips until a click is heard

  • the cover (3) for the door handle. Use a weatherstrip tool

  • the two screws (4) from under the cover

  • the door panel. Slide the panel upwards and unhook the top edge

  • the mechanical lock cable and existing connectors. Place the door panel to one side.

Illustration B applies to the S80

    Remove:

  • the clips (1). First press in the centre of the clips until a click is heard

  • the blind cover plug (2) and the screw from under the washer

  • the surround (3) around the handle carefully. Use a weatherstrip tool for example

  • the cover for the door mirror (4). Pull the cover straight out

  • the door panel (5). First unhook the panel. Then lift the panel out

  • the mechanical lock cable and existing connectors. Place the door panel to one side.

  • Disconnect the connector (1)

  • Remove the nut (2) and the door mirror.

5
M8400956
 

    Transferring the mirror glass, removal

  • Fold the mirror glass inwards as illustrated

  • Insert a weatherstrip tool at the inner edge, as illustrated. Carefully turn / pry while pulling out the outer edge so that the external catch releases

  • Work out the glass

  • Remove the terminal pins from the mirror glass.

Installing the door mirror

    Transferring the mirror glass, installation

  • Connect the terminal pins to the new mirror glass

  • Fold out the mirror mounting on the motor

  • Ensure that both glide rails on the mirror are in the grooves. Hook the mirror glass into the inner mounting. Press the mirror glass into place.

    Reinstalling the painted cover

  • Reinstall the rear edge of the cover. Work the cover into place against the surround

  • Press the cover in under the surround. Ensure that all hooks click into place.


    Note!

    The cover must slide into place with a minimum of force. Do not attempt to reinstall the cover forcibly.

Installing the switch in the panel

Applies to the S60 and V70 (00-)

  • Remove the panel in front of the gear selector lever. Carefully pry off the panel using a plastic weatherstrip tool

  • Move the gear selector lever as far back as possible.

Illustration A applies to the S60, and V70 (00-)

  • Press in the catches on the front edge of the gear selector lever panel. Lift the panel upwards, first the front edge and then the rear edge. Remove the panel around the gear selector lever.

Illustration B applies to the S80

  • Carefully remove the panel (1) and the boot. Pry carefully using a weatherstrip tool.

Illustration A applies to the S60 and the V70 (00-)

  • Remove the two screws from the dashboard environment panel.

Illustration B applies to the S80

  • Move the gear selector lever as far back as possible

  • Pull the panel (1) and the boot as far backwards as possible. Turn the panel as illustrated

  • Remove the screws (2) from the dashboard environment panel (3).

13
M8503045
 

  • Carefully angle the dashboard environment panel out using a plastic weatherstrip tool so that it is possible to insert a couple of fingers to gain access to the side of the dashboard environmental panel

  • Remove the dashboard environment panel. Pull it downward, maintaining the same angle

  • Disconnect the connectors on the reverse of the dashboard environment panel.


    Note!

    If any of the outer hooks break off, these must be repaired. See the section dealing with the dashboard in VIDA.

  • Remove the cigarette lighter

  • Position the dashboard environmental panel as illustrated

  • Detach the surround (1) by carefully pushing down the three catches (2) in the holes (3) using a small screwdriver. At the same time pry out the surround using a thin weatherstrip tool. Starting at the 12 volt socket (4), pry up one corner. The surround is tightly secured so take care not to damage any components

  • Remove the surround.

15
D8502226
 

  • See the owner's manual for the position of the switch

  • Remove the switch blank. Install the new switch (1)

  • Reinstall the surround and the cigarette lighter

  • Connect the connectors to the dashboard environment panel. Reinstall the dashboard environment panel. See point -

  • Reinstall the panel around the gear selector lever and the panel in front of the gear selector lever.

Finishing work

  • Turn the ignition key to position II

  • Reconnect the battery negative lead

  • Program the software according to the service information in VIDA.
